Fabric History/Pedigree: Pieces received from traditional Japanese kimono cleaner/reconstructor called Arai-Hari -- see an excellent explanation of traditional Arai Hari by textile expert John Marshall,by click-pushing HERE.

Fabric Description:  Lightweight fine silk is a 1980's piece originally intended to make a woman's under-kimono (nagajuban); not as thin as most nagajubans we see, definitely higher grade silk; fabric background color is a pale peachy-pink (in lower incandescent light it looks pink); the fabric is fully interwoven with background pinstripes running vertically(lengthwise) with images of classic stylized cloud shapes and flowers; Within the clouds are the tiny shibori dotted-diamonds fields;
